LG G3 is just a bit better than Asus Zenfone 9, with a 76.4 score against 72.6. The LG G3 is an extremely older device than Asus Zenfone 9, but it's a bit thinner and somewhat lighter anyway. These devices work with Android OS (Operating System), but the LG G3 has an older 5.0 version and Asus Zenfone 9 has Android 12 version.
LG G3 features a really superior hardware performance than Asus Zenfone 9, because although it has less RAM and an inferior number of cores , it also counts with an extra graphics processor. The LG G3 counts with an incredibly better looking screen than Asus Zenfone 9, because although it has a little bit smaller display, it also counts with a higher 2560 x 1440 pixels resolution and a just a bit better number of pixels in each inch of screen.
Asus Zenfone 9 features a lot bigger memory capacity for games and applications than LG G3, because although it has no slot for an external memory card, it also counts with 128 GB internal storage capacity. Asus Zenfone 9 features a way better battery duration than LG G3, because it has a 43% greater battery capacity.
Asus Zenfone 9 shoots a lot better photos and videos than LG G3, because it has a way bigger aperture to capture better low light captures and video, a way bigger back camera sensor shooting lot better quality pictures and videos, a back camera with a much better 50 mega pixels resolution and a way better video definition.
